Brand Campaign Marketing Manager/Beauty Brands experience

Londontown, Inc.

Remote Posted Jul 7, 2026
Full TimeDigital Marketing

Job Description

Brand Marketing & Campaign Manager Full-Time | Remote Hours:8am to 4.30pm US EST Monday to Fri day LONDONTOWN is a clean beauty brand redefining nail care through innovative products, elevated storytelling, and a commitment to healthier beauty routines. We are seeking a Brand Marketing & Campaign Manager to help shape how consumers experience and connect with our brand across every touchpoint. This is a hands-on role for a strategic marketer who understands how to blend brand storytelling, consumer insights, creative direction, product launches, partnerships, and campaign execution into a cohesive brand experience. You will work closely with leadership, creative, digital marketing, PR, social, and ecommerce teams to bring the brand to life while driving awareness, engagement, and growth. What You'll Do Brand Strategy & Storytelling Help define and evolve Londontown's brand positioning, messaging, and storytelling. Ensure brand consistency across all consumer touchpoints, including ecommerce, social media, email, retail, PR, influencer, and packaging. Translate consumer insights and market trends into compelling campaigns and brand initiatives. Partner with creative teams to develop campaign concepts, creative briefs, messaging frameworks, and launch narratives. Product Launches & Go-To-Market Strategy Lead and execute 360° go-to-market plans for new product launches and key campaigns. Coordinate launch calendars, messaging, assets, timelines, and cross-functional execution. Develop launch toolkits and activation plans across ecommerce, social, influencer, email, retail, and PR channels. Monitor launch performance and provide actionable recommendations for optimization. Campaign Development & Execution Manage integrated marketing campaigns from concept through execution and post-campaign analysis. Collaborate with creative, social, ecommerce, influencer, and PR teams to ensure campaigns are aligned and delivered on time. Support influencer, creator, community, and partnership initiatives that strengthen brand awareness and engagement. Contribute to content planning and campaign storytelling across all channels. Consumer Insights & Performance Analysis Analyze campaign, category, and consumer performance data to identify growth opportunities. Conduct competitive analysis and market research to support brand and product strategies. Develop campaign recaps and recommendations that improve future performance. Use insights to influence creative direction, messaging, and marketing investment decisions. Partnerships & Brand Growth Build and support strategic partnerships with retailers, influencers, creators, media partners, and aligned brands. Identify opportunities to increase brand visibility, engagement, and customer acquisition. Support events, activations, sampling, gifting, and community-building initiatives. Qualifications 4–8 years of experience in Brand Marketing, Product Marketing, Campaign Marketing, or Go-To-Market roles. Beauty, skincare, wellness, personal care, luxury, or consumer product experience strongly preferred. Proven experience leading product launches and integrated marketing campaigns. Strong understanding of brand positioning, storytelling, and consumer engagement. Experience collaborating with creative, social, PR, influencer, ecommerce, and retail teams. Comfortable using data and consumer insights to inform marketing decisions. Exceptional project management and communication skills. Copywriting experience a major PLUS! Highly organized, proactive, and comfortable working in a fast-paced entrepreneurial environment. Experience with retailers such as Sephora, Ulta, Amazon, Target, Walmart, or similar is a plus.
